Happenstance Theater's Pinot and Augustine
Happenstance Theater is a professional company committed to devising, producing and touring original, performer-created visual, poetic Theatre. Under the artistic co-direction of Mark Jaster and Sabrina Mandell they harvest imagery from the past and re-contextualize it in works that address eternal themes of life and death. With the simplest means - humor, music, movement, silence, text and beauty - they seek to elevate the moment when the performers and audience meet, to lift the encounter beyond the daily and pedestrian into the realms of dreams, poetry, and art. Meaning is often discovered by happenstance. The Washington City Paper says, “Happenstance Theater’s ensemble comedy is a gut-busting kind of funny.” The Washington Post describes their work as, “visually striking and whimsical without being precious,” and calls Happenstance Theater "DC’s leading peddler of whimsy.” In 2016 Happenstance received three Helen Hayes Awards for Outstanding Ensemble, Outstanding Costume Design and Outstanding Lead Actor. In 2017 Happenstance received two Helen Hayes Awards for Outstanding Costume Design and Outstanding Musical Direction.
